Output 8e6c63145f29739bc580ecebfcc2aaf4c80bbe88b039646952bc908e0f91d58a:6

value
649600616
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 414e9c4c9981142e28b34c7d706de42c4fcda639 OP_EQUALVERIFY OP_CHECKSIG
address
16xK6RfmJbASf9hmA5sWo9UcDSUekx4RjG
transaction
8e6c63145f29739bc580ecebfcc2aaf4c80bbe88b039646952bc908e0f91d58a
spent
true